Glasgow Landlord Gas Safety Obligations
Under the Gas Safety (Installation and Use) Regulations 1998, every Glasgow landlord must ensure annual gas safety checks are carried out on all gas appliances, flues, and fittings in rental properties. This applies to all tenancy types including HMOs, BTL properties, and social housing.
What's Included in Glasgow Gas Safety Checks
Appliance Inspections
- Boiler safety checks: Combustion, ventilation, and operation
- Gas fires and heaters: Installation and safety device testing
- Gas cookers: Connection integrity and safety features
- Gas water heaters: Performance and ventilation checks
- Any other gas appliances: Including meters and pipework
Flue and Ventilation Checks
- Flue integrity and flow testing
- Adequate ventilation provision
- Combustion air supply verification
- Flue gas spillage testing
- Carbon monoxide leak detection
CP12 Gas Safety Certificate Requirements
Certificate Details
The CP12 (Landlord's Gas Safety Record) must include detailed information about each appliance tested, any defects found, remedial actions taken, and confirmation that all appliances are safe for continued use.

⚠️ Legal Timeline Requirements
Glasgow landlords must:
- • Arrange checks within 12 months of previous certificate
- • Provide copy to existing tenants within 28 days
- • Give copy to new tenants before they move in
- • Keep records for at least 2 years
- • Ensure immediate access for emergency repairs

Consequences of Non-Compliance
Glasgow landlords who fail to arrange annual gas safety checks face:
- Fines up to £6,000 per property
- Up to 6 months imprisonment
- Insurance claims being void
- Difficulty obtaining landlord insurance
- Council enforcement action
- Tenant claims for unsafe accommodation

Glasgow Landlord Gas Check Costs
Professional gas safety checks in Glasgow typically cost:
- Standard property (1-2 appliances): £80-120
- Multiple appliances (3-5): £120-180
- HMO properties: £150-250
- Emergency compliance checks: Add £50-100
- Remedial work: Quoted separately
